Foundation Repair in Tampa, FL
Foundation repair services address issues related to the stability and integrity of a property's foundation. These services typically cover projects such as stabilizing settling foundations, repairing cracks, and addressing uneven or bowed walls. Homeowners often seek foundation repair when noticing signs like cracked walls, sticking doors or windows, uneven flooring, or visible shifts in the structure. Understanding the extent of foundation movement and the underlying causes is essential before requesting repairs, as these factors influence the appropriate solutions and methods used.
Property owners should consider the specific conditions of their foundation, including the type of soil, age of the structure, and the severity of any damage. It is important to evaluate whether issues are isolated or part of ongoing settlement, as this impacts the scope of work needed. Proper assessment and timely intervention can help prevent further structural damage and maintain the safety and value of the property.

Common Foundation Repair Jobs
Foundation stabilization - methods to reinforce and strengthen settling or shifting foundations.
Crack repair - sealing and filling foundation cracks to prevent further damage.
Pier and beam foundation repair - addressing issues with raised or sagging wooden supports.
Concrete slab repair - fixing uneven or cracked concrete slabs to improve stability.
Waterproofing services - protecting foundations from water intrusion and moisture damage.
Settlement correction - leveling and adjusting foundations to restore proper alignment.
Foundation Repair Questions
What are signs of foundation problems? Common signs include cracks in walls or floors, uneven flooring, and doors or windows that stick or don’t close properly.
How does foundation repair improve property safety? Repairing the foundation helps prevent further damage, ensuring the stability and safety of the structure.
What types of foundation repair methods are available? Methods include underpinning, piering, and slab stabilization, chosen based on the specific issue and foundation type.
When should property owners consider foundation repair? Repair should be considered when signs of settling, cracking, or shifting are observed, especially if they worsen over time.
